Ingredients List
Gather these simple ingredients to make the most delicious 30 Minute Air Fryer Turkey Patties:
- 1 pound ground turkey (fresh or thawed)
- 1/4 cup breadcrumbs (preferably seasoned for extra flavor)
- 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ese (freshly grated works best)
- 1 egg (large, for binding)
- 2 cloves garlic, minced (or more if you’re a garlic lover!)
- 1 teaspoon onion powder (for a subtle sweetness)
- 1 teaspoon salt (to enhance all those lovely flavors)
- 1/2 teaspoon pepper (adjust to taste)
- 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ning (for that herby kick)

How to Prepare Instructions
Now that you have your ingredients ready, let’s dive into making these scrumptious 30 Minute Air Fryer Turkey Patties! Follow these simple steps, and you’ll have perfectly cooked patties in no time.
Preheat the Air Fryer
First things first, preheating your air fryer is essential! It not only ensures even cooking but also helps achieve that lovely golden-brown exterior. Preheat your air fryer to 400°F (about 200°C) for around 5 minutes. This quick step makes a world of difference, trust me!
Mix the Ingredients
In a large mixing bowl, combine the ground turkey, breadcrumbs, grated Parmesan, egg, minced garlic, onion powder, salt, pepper, and Italian seasoning. Use your hands or a spoon to gently mix everything together until just combined. You want to avoid overmixing, as that can make the patties tough. The mixture should be moist but hold together nicely. If it feels too wet, you can sprinkle in a bit more breadcrumbs!
Form the Patties
Now it’s time to shape the patties! Grab a handful of the mixture and roll it into a ball, then gently flatten it into a patty about half an inch thick. I usually aim for patties around 4 inches in diameter; this size cooks evenly and fits nicely in the air fryer. Make sure they’re uniform in size so they cook at the same rate.
Cooking the Patties
Carefully place the patties in a single layer in the air fryer basket, making sure not to overcrowd them. Depending on the size of your air fryer, you may need to cook them in batches. Cook for 12-15 minutes, flipping them halfway through to ensure both sides get that beautiful crisp. You’ll know they’re done when they reach an internal temperature of 165°F (75°C). Use a meat thermometer if you have one—it’s the best way to ensure they’re perfectly cooked!

Tips for Success
Want to take your 30 Minute Air Fryer Turkey Patties to the next level? Here are some pro tips that I swear by!
- Don’t Overmix: When combining your ingredients, mix just until everything is incorporated. Overmixing can lead to tough patties, and nobody wants that!
- Use Fresh Ingredients: Freshly grated cheese and minced garlic elevate the flavor tremendously. Trust me, it makes a difference!
- Adjust Seasonings: Feel free to play around with the spices. If you love a kick, add some red pepper flakes or a dash of hot sauce to the mix.
- Keep Patties Moist: If your mixture seems dry, a splash of milk or a bit more grated cheese can help maintain moisture.
- Check the Temperature: Always use a meat thermometer to ensure your patties hit 165°F (75°C) for perfectly cooked goodness!

Storage & Reheating Instructions
Storing your leftover 30 Minute Air Fryer Turkey Patties is super easy! Just place them in an airtight container in the refrigerator, where they’ll stay fresh for up to 3 days. If you want to keep them longer, you can freeze them! Just make sure to wrap each patty tightly in plastic wrap or foil before placing them in a freezer-safe bag. When you’re ready to enjoy them again, simply reheat the patties in the air fryer at 350°F for about 5-7 minutes, or until heated through. Can I use ground chicken instead of turkey?
Absolutely! Ground chicken is a great substitute for turkey in this recipe. It will give you a slightly different flavor, but the cooking method remains the same. Just make sure to check the internal temperature to ensure it reaches 165°F (75°C) as well!
How do I know when the patties are cooked through?
The best way to check for doneness is to use a meat thermometer. Make sure the internal temperature reaches 165°F (75°C). If you don’t have one, you can cut a patty in half to check for any pinkness inside, but trust me, a thermometer is the most reliable method!
Can I freeze the uncooked patties?
Yes, you can freeze the uncooked patties! Just shape them as directed, then place them on a baking sheet in the freezer until firm. Once frozen, transfer them to a freezer-safe bag. When you’re ready to cook, no need to thaw—just pop them into the air fryer and add a couple of extra minutes to the cooking time!
What can I substitute for breadcrumbs?
If you don’t have breadcrumbs on hand, you can use crushed crackers or even oats as a substitute. Just keep in mind that the texture might vary slightly. You can also use gluten-free breadcrumbs if you’re looking for a gluten-free option!
